I can confirm I had this exact same thing happen. Once I elected to convert my PayPal Credit acct to MasterCard acct the Credit went away from the Wallet list & there was nothing but my debit card shown. (In other words the PayPal MC was not there) I waited a few days after getting card in mail & eventually called support. They said it takes a few days (even though it already had been) but eventually it showed up. Not sure if calling did the trick or if I just didn't wait long enough.

 

Not sure if they'll work or what they'll do if you don't have PayPal MasterCard linked but try logging into paypal 1st then here is direct link to PayPal MC status screen:

https://www.paypal.com/myaccount/wallet/creditProduct/extrasmastercard

Here is direct link to make PayPal MC payment:

https://www.paypal.com/cgi-bin/webscr?cmd=_bcsweb-make-payment

Here is direct link to PayPal MC payment history:

https://www.paypal.com/us/cgi-bin/bcsweb?cmd=_bcsweb-view-payment-history

Direct link to PayPal MC statements (redirects to synchrony site with custom URL):

https://www.paypal.com/cgi-bin/bcsweb?cmd=_profile-bc-vendor-transition

 

Now we all just need to bug PayPal to add autopay option..
